Responsibilities Lead and Innovate in Teaching : Deliver core design studios, coordinate professional practice subjects, and engage students through design‑based learning. Advance Research and Scholarship : Conduct and collaborate on research initiatives, publishing findings and presenting at conferences. Strengthen Professional Connections : Build relationships with industry bodies and design practices, enhancing program visibility and value. Mentor and Support : Guide students and early‑career designers toward professional registration and practice. Qualifications and Experience You will be an experienced landscape architect with a passion for teaching and research, possessing a strong understanding of contemporary design practices and a collaborative approach to engage with colleagues and industry. PhD or equivalent in landscape architecture with professional experience. Demonstrated excellence in design studio teaching and interdisciplinary collaboration. Strong communication skills and the ability to build networks with industry. Experience in academic administration and a willingness to undertake various roles. Team The Faculty of Architecture, Building and Planning is the leading educational and research institution in the Asia‑Pacific region, addressing the design and realisation of inhabited environments. It actively seeks to extend linkages between education, research and practice in the built environment, and maintains excellent and extensive relationships with members of the built environment professions, government, professional associations and the wider community.
